Pytania oznaczone «abstraction»

Użyj tego znacznika w odniesieniu do abstrakcji sprzętu, na przykład tego, jak system Windows może używać tych samych interfejsów API nawet na innym sprzęcie, lub dowolnej innej metody, w której rzeczywistość jest oddzielona programowo od programów na poziomie użytkownika. Nie należy tego używać do emulacji.

38
Co to jest abstrakcja? [Zamknięte]

Czy istnieje ogólnie uzgodniona definicja tego, czym jest abstrakcja programowania , stosowana przez programistów? [Uwaga: abstrakcji programowej nie należy mylić z definicjami słownika dla słowa „abstrakcja”.] Czy istnieje jednoznaczna, a nawet matematyczna definicja? Jakie są jasne przykłady...

35
Jak określić poziomy abstrakcji

Czytałem dziś książkę zatytułowaną „Czysty kod” i natknąłem się na akapit, w którym autor mówił o poziomach abstrakcji dla funkcji, sklasyfikował jakiś kod jako niski / średni / wysoki poziom abstrakcji. Moje pytanie brzmi: jakie są kryteria określania poziomu abstrakcji? Cytuję akapit z...

32
Abstrakcyjny typ danych i struktura danych

Bardzo trudno jest mi zrozumieć te warunki. Szukałem w Google i czytałem trochę na Wikipedii, ale nadal nie jestem pewien. Do tej pory ustaliłem, że: Abstrakcyjny typ danych to definicja nowego typu, opisująca jego właściwości i działanie. Struktura danych jest implementacją ADT. Wiele ADT może...

16
Mylić z definicją „abstrakcji” w OOP

Próbuję zrozumieć definicję „abstrakcji” w OOP. Natknąłem się na kilka głównych definicji. Czy wszystkie są ważne? Czy któryś z nich się myli? Jestem zmieszany. (Ponownie napisałem definicję własnymi słowami). Definicja 1: Abstrakcja to koncepcja pobierania jakiegoś obiektu ze świata...